The Rise of Solar Power
Solar power has gained incredible momentum in recent years. The plummeting cost of solar panels, advancements in technology, and growing environmental awareness have all contributed to the rapid adoption of solar energy. What was once considered a niche technology is now becoming mainstream, reshaping how we power our homes and communities.
The most common way to harness solar power for residential use is through rooftop solar panels. These photovoltaic (PV) panels are designed to capture sunlight and convert it into electricity. As the sun’s rays hit the panels, electrons are set in motion, generating a flow of electricity that can be used to power your home. The excess energy can be stored in batteries or fed back into the grid, earning you credits or even income through net metering programs.
The Advantages of Solar-Powered Homes
Solar-powered homes offer a plethora of benefits, making them an attractive option for homeowners and the environment alike.
1. Clean and Renewable Energy
Solar power is one of the cleanest and most abundant sources of energy on Earth. Unlike fossil fuels, which produce harmful emissions and contribute to air pollution and climate change, solar energy is renewable and emits no greenhouse gases. By investing in solar panels, homeowners can significantly reduce their carbon footprint and contribute to a cleaner planet.
2. Energy Independence
One of the significant advantages of solar-powered homes is energy independence. By generating your electricity, you are less reliant on external energy sources, such as coal or natural gas. This not only insulates you from energy price fluctuations but also reduces your vulnerability to power outages. With the right storage solutions, you can have a consistent power supply even during grid failures or natural disasters.
3. Financial Savings
While the initial investment in solar panels may seem daunting, it’s essential to consider the long-term financial benefits. Solar panels typically pay for themselves over time through reduced electricity bills and, in some cases, government incentives and rebates. Moreover, as solar technology advances, the efficiency and affordability of solar panels continue to improve, making them an even more attractive investment.
4. Increased Property Value
Solar-powered homes tend to have higher property values. Homebuyers are increasingly looking for energy-efficient features, and solar panels are a compelling selling point. They not only lower operating costs but also enhance the overall appeal of a property. As such, installing solar panels can be considered an investment in your home’s resale value.
The Technological Advances in Solar Power
The solar industry has witnessed significant technological advancements that have further solidified solar power’s position as the future of residential energy.
1. Increased Efficiency
Newer solar panels are more efficient at converting sunlight into electricity. This means that even in areas with less sunshine, homeowners can generate ample power. Improved efficiency also translates to smaller and more aesthetically pleasing panels, allowing for better integration into residential architecture.
2. Energy Storage Solutions
Energy storage solutions, such as lithium-ion batteries, have revolutionized how solar power can be used. These batteries store excess energy generated during the day and release it when the sun isn’t shining. This ensures a steady power supply, day or night, further enhancing the reliability of solar-powered homes.
3. Smart Home Integration
Solar-powered homes can be seamlessly integrated with smart home technology. Smart inverters and monitoring systems allow homeowners to track their energy production and consumption in real-time. This data empowers homeowners to optimize their energy usage and make informed decisions about when to use stored energy or sell it back to the grid for maximum financial benefit.
The Environmental Impact
Choosing solar power for your home is not just a smart financial decision; it’s also an environmentally responsible one. By reducing your reliance on fossil fuels, you help combat climate change and protect the environment. The environmental benefits of solar power include:
1. Reduced Carbon Emissions
Switching to solar power significantly reduces your carbon emissions. The electricity generated from solar panels produces zero greenhouse gas emissions, helping to combat climate change and reduce air pollution.
2. Conservation of Natural Resources
Solar power reduces the demand for fossil fuels like coal and natural gas. By using the sun’s energy, we can preserve finite resources and minimize the environmental damage caused by extracting and burning fossil fuels.
3. Protection of Ecosystems
Extracting fossil fuels often involves disrupting fragile ecosystems, leading to habitat destruction and environmental degradation. Solar power generation, on the other hand, has a much smaller ecological footprint and helps protect biodiversity.
